1. Let's Start at the Very Beginning…
My name is Lorelei Schulz. I have lived most of my life in Austria. My family had a large estate at the base of the mountains. My closest friend was my sister, Agathe. She was older than I, but we were seldom found without each other. We shared the same love of music, and of the mountains.
My sister became acquainted with a gentleman by the name of Georg von Trapp. They fell in love, and were soon married. Georg was like a brother to me, and I loved him dearly as such. I spent much of my time with him and Agathe and their children, my nieces and nephews. It was one of the happiest times of my life.
Then, the scarlet fever broke out. My sister, Agathe… She died. I almost think it hit Georg harder than me. He seemed to grow older, stiffer, more stern and strict overnight. He pushed my out of his life entirely. Maybe it was because I reminded him too much of my sister. I don't know. I wasn't allowed to see him or the children. He isolated himself from his family as well. He spent much of his time in Vienna, in the company of one Baroness Elsa Schrader. The children were left in the care of governesses. However, they succeeded in driving then away. I was secretly proud of them. They inherited that spirit from their mother.
I only hoped that one day there will be a change…
